BOS descriptor (scheme.rs:1900-1905): - Uncommented fetch_bos_desc() call that was disabled with TODO - Now reads Binary Object Store descriptor at device enumeration time - Enables proper USB 3.x SuperSpeed detection via bos_capability_descs (was hardcoded to supports_superspeed = false) - Supports both SuperSpeed and SuperSpeedPlus capability detection - Cross-referenced with Linux 7.1 drivers/usb/core/config.c:387-420 Event ring growth (irq_reactor.rs:551-575): - Replaced "TODO: grow event ring" stub with ring-reset implementation - On EventRingFull: resets all TRBs to Invalid with inverted cycle bit, then writes ERDP back to ring base address - Linux uses multi-segment ERST expansion; we use ring-reset which achieves the same reliability benefit without segment management - Includes ZERO_64B_REGS quirk-aware ERDP write ordering - Cross-referenced with Linux 7.1 xhci-ring.c:570-590 --- drivers/usb/xhcid/src/xhci/irq_reactor.rs | 22 +++++++++++++++++++--- drivers/usb/xhcid/src/xhci/scheme.rs | 8 +++----- 2 files changed, 22 insertions(+), 8 deletions(-) diff --git a/drivers/usb/xhcid/src/xhci/irq_reactor.rs b/drivers/usb/xhcid/src/xhci/irq_reactor.rs index b452e3a4ec..098f4d14c1 100644 --- a/drivers/usb/xhcid/src/xhci/irq_reactor.rs +++ b/drivers/usb/xhcid/src/xhci/irq_reactor.rs @@ -547,10 +547,26 @@ impl IrqReactor { } had_event_ring_full_error } - /// Grows the event ring fn grow_event_ring(&mut self) { - // TODO - error!("TODO: grow event ring"); + let mut event_ring = self.hci.primary_event_ring.lock().unwrap_or_else(|e| e.into_inner()); + let cycle = event_ring.ring.cycle; + for trb in event_ring.ring.trbs.iter_mut() { + trb.reserved(!cycle); + } + let dequeue_pointer = event_ring.ring.register() & 0xFFFF_FFFF_FFFF_FFF0; + drop(event_ring); + + let zero_64b = self.hci.quirks.contains(crate::xhci::quirks::XhciQuirks::ZERO_64B_REGS); + let mut run = self.hci.run.lock().unwrap_or_else(|e| e.into_inner()); + if zero_64b { + run.ints[0].erdp_high.write((dequeue_pointer >> 32) as u32); + run.ints[0].erdp_low.write(dequeue_pointer as u32 | (1 << 3)); + } else { + run.ints[0].erdp_low.write(dequeue_pointer as u32 | (1 << 3)); + run.ints[0].erdp_high.write((dequeue_pointer >> 32) as u32); + } + + log::warn!("xhcid: event ring full — reset to ERDP={:#x}", dequeue_pointer); } pub fn run(self) -> ! { diff --git a/drivers/usb/xhcid/src/xhci/scheme.rs b/drivers/usb/xhcid/src/xhci/scheme.rs index 8252198133..11b6e1e788 100644 --- a/drivers/usb/xhcid/src/xhci/scheme.rs +++ b/drivers/usb/xhcid/src/xhci/scheme.rs @@ -1897,12 +1897,10 @@ impl Xhci { serial_str ); - //TODO let (bos_desc, bos_data) = self.fetch_bos_desc(port_id, slot).await?; + let (bos_desc, bos_data) = self.fetch_bos_desc(port_id, slot).await?; - let supports_superspeed = false; - //TODO usb::bos_capability_descs(bos_desc, &bos_data).any(|desc| desc.is_superspeed()); - let supports_superspeedplus = false; - //TODO usb::bos_capability_descs(bos_desc, &bos_data).any(|desc| desc.is_superspeedplus()); + let supports_superspeed = usb::bos_capability_descs(bos_desc, &bos_data).any(|desc| desc.is_superspeed()); + let supports_superspeedplus = usb::bos_capability_descs(bos_desc, &bos_data).any(|desc| desc.is_superspeedplus()); let mut config_descs = SmallVec::new();
